About Pushpa Verma
Pushpa Verma is a scholar working on Molecular Biology, Cancer Research, Cellular and Molecular Neuroscience, Plant Science and Aquatic Science, having authored 6 papers that have together received 322 indexed citations. Recurring topics across this work include MicroRNA in disease regulation (3 papers), Chromosomal and Genetic Variations (2 papers), RNA Interference and Gene Delivery (2 papers), Neurobiology and Insect Physiology Research (2 papers), Invertebrate Immune Response Mechanisms (1 paper), Neurogenesis and neuroplasticity mechanisms (1 paper), Silk-based biomaterials and applications (1 paper) and CRISPR and Genetic Engineering (1 paper). The work is most often cited by research in Aging (33 citations), Cancer Research (142 citations), Cellular and Molecular Neuroscience (82 citations), Aquatic Science (28 citations) and Endocrine and Autonomic Systems (25 citations). Pushpa Verma has collaborated with scholars based in Singapore, South Korea and United Kingdom. Frequent co-authors include Stephen M. Cohen, Ruifen Weng, Ya‐Wen Chen, Jan‐Michael Kugler, Marita Buescher, Sigrid Rouam, Ya‐Wen Chen, George J Augustine, Ayumu Tashiro and Stephen D. Liberles. Their work appears in journals such as eLife, Genes & Development, Developmental Cell, Genetics and Nature Neuroscience.
